Responsibilities

  • Prospect, develop, propose, and bind new business
  • Actively pursue new client prospects through telemarketing, networking, and personal referrals
  • Assist in the collection of required coverage information and necessary deposit and renewal premiums
  • Maintain the proper documentation for existing and prospective clients
  • Oversee all aspects of your new clients with the assigned account manager
  • Drive and support cross-selling strategies for existing clients, as well as new relationships
  • Foster and seek relationships with teammates across all levels of Brown & Brown
  • Ensure compliance with government agencies and corporate policies and procedures
  • Attend training sessions, courses, etc. to maintain up-to-date skills
  • Always conduct the highest level of confidentiality
